The Basics of Aquaponics
Before diving into the specifics of what to grow in your aquaponics system, it’s essential to grasp the foundational concepts. In a typical aquaponics setup, nutrients produced by fish waste are converted by beneficial bacteria into forms that plants can absorb. The plants, in turn, filter and clean the water, which is then cycled back to the fish. This closed-loop system simplifies farming and significantly reduces water consumption.
Key Factors Influencing Plant Selection
While aquaponics allows for a vast range of crops, certain factors will dictate what can thrive in your garden:
Environmental Conditions
Different plants have varied temperature, light, and humidity requirements. Assess your local climate and set up your garden accordingly. Most aquaponics systems are designed for indoor or semi-controlled environments, allowing year-round growth.
Fish Compatibility
The species of fish you select will impact your crop choice. Different fish produce varying concentrations of nutrients. For example, tilapia is known for high nutrient output, making it suitable for a broader array of heavy-feeding plants.
System Size
The scale of your aquaponics system will dictate how many and which plants can be grown. Smaller systems may work best with quick-growing, smaller plants, while larger systems can accommodate more extensive crops.
Vegetables: The Staples of Aquaponics
Aquaponics is particularly adept at showcasing a variety of vegetables. Here are some popular choices that thrive in aquaponic environments:
Lettuce and Greens
Leafy greens such as lettuce, arugula, kale, and spinach are commonly grown in aquaponics. They have fast growth cycles and require minimal nutrients, making them ideal for beginners:
- Lettuce: Grows quickly and can be harvested multiple times.
- Kale: Tolerant in varied conditions and full of nutrients.
Herbs
Herbs contribute valuable flavors to culinary dishes and can be grown in compact spaces. A few notable examples include:
Basil
Basil flourishes in warm temperatures and is an excellent addition to salads, sauces, and various dishes. Its growth habit is such that it can easily be managed in a small area.
Mint
Mint is another herb that thrives in aquaponics, though it can be invasive. Growing it in a separate container within the system can help manage its growth.
Fruit-Bearing Plants
While somewhat more challenging, it is certainly possible to cultivate fruit-bearing plants in aquaponics. However, they generally require more nutrients and a bigger commitment.
Tomatoes
Tomatoes are a favorite among aquaponic gardeners. They fruit continually throughout the growing season and can thrive with the right care:
- Varieties: Choose from determinate (bushy type) and indeterminate (vining type) based on your space availability.
- Care tips: Ensure adequate light and provide support as they climb.
Cucumbers
Cucumbers can be quite productive in aquaponics. They prefer warmer temperatures and a consistent water temperature, ideally between 70°F and 85°F.
Peppers
From bell peppers to hot varieties, peppers can thrive in aquaponic conditions. They require ample sunlight and can be quite productive in well-controlled environments.
Fruits and Berries
Growing fruits in aquaponics can be rewarding, but it often requires more experience. Here are a few that have shown success:
Strawberries
Strawberries require a bit of extra care and the right conditions – they do well in vertical stacking systems.
Tips for Growing Strawberries
- Light: Ensure they receive about 10-12 hours of sunlight daily.
- pH Balance: Maintain an optimal pH range of 5.5-7.0 for best results.
Grapes
Grapes can also be cultivated in aquaponic systems, although they require substantial space and support. Their requirement for sunlight can make it a bit tricky but offers sweet rewards if managed correctly.
Fruit | Light Requirements | Support Needed |
---|---|---|
Strawberries | 10-12 hours | Vertical stacking systems |
Grapes | Full sun | Trellis or arbor |
Other Unique Options for Aquaponics
While the staples mentioned above form a solid foundation, aquaponics offers pathways for innovative growing as well.
Microgreens
Microgreens are dense in nutrients and can grow rapidly. This includes radish greens, sunflower shoots, and pea shoots. They thrive in high nutrient environments and are an excellent way for beginners to gain confidence in aquaponics.
Flowers
Certain edible flowers, such as nasturtium or pansies, can also flourish in an aquaponics setup. They can boost biodiversity while providing culinary uses as decorative garnishes or salad additions.

Can I grow fruit trees in an aquaponics system?
Growing fruit trees in an aquaponics system is possible, but it requires special considerations. Dwarf varieties or younger trees are typically more feasible options because they have smaller root structures and can adapt to the system’s environment more effectively. Popular choices include dwarf citrus trees and figs, as they can produce fruit without taking up too much space.
Keep in mind that fruit trees generally take longer to mature and may require more nutrients and care compared to smaller plants. Regular monitoring of nutrient levels and ensuring adequate support for the trees as they grow will contribute to a successful fruit-bearing aquaponics garden.
What fish should I choose for my aquaponics system?
The choice of fish is crucial to the success of your aquaponics garden as different species have different requirements and produce varying amounts of waste, which in turn affects the nutrient levels in the water. Tilapia is a popular option due to its hardiness, rapid growth, and ability to tolerate a range of water conditions. Other suitable species include catfish and trout, depending on your local climate and regulations.
When selecting fish, consider factors such as water temperature, pH levels, and oxygen requirements. It’s vital to maintain a balanced ecosystem, so be sure to research each species’ compatibility with the plants you’re growing and the overall setup of your aquaponics system.
How often should I monitor my aquaponics system?
Regular monitoring of your aquaponics system is essential to ensure its health and productivity. A good practice is to check water parameters, such as pH, ammonia, nitrite, and nitrate levels, at least once a week. These indicators help you maintain a balanced environment for both fish and plants and identify any potential issues early on.
Additionally, inspecting plants for signs of nutrient deficiencies or pests is vital. If any issues arise, adjusting feeding practices or performing water changes may be necessary to keep the system functioning smoothly. Consistent monitoring will allow you to create a thriving aquaponics ecosystem.
What are the common challenges faced in aquaponics gardening?
Aquaponics gardening comes with its own set of challenges that may differ from traditional soil gardening. One common issue is maintaining a stable balance between the fish and plant populations. If the fish produce too much waste or too little, it can lead to nutrient imbalances, affecting plant health. Keep a close eye on the number of fish and plants to ensure they remain in harmony.
Another challenge can be disease management. With aquatic and terrestrial components, there may be a higher risk of diseases that can spread quickly. It’s essential to be proactive in maintaining biosecurity measures, such as sanitizing equipment and monitoring the health of both fish and plants to mitigate any potential outbreaks.
